Thermal Performance Factors of Aluminum-Tube Freezer Finned Tube Radiators
An Aluminum-Tube Freezer Finned Tube Radiator is a key component that influences refrigeration efficiency, temperature stability, and equipment reliability. In freezer systems, the radiator needs to maintain continuous heat transfer under low-temperature conditions, where airflow resistance, frost formation, humidity, and long operating cycles can directly affect overall cooling performance.
The thermal performance of a finned tube radiator is determined by multiple factors, including tube material, fin arrangement, heat transfer area, refrigerant flow path, and airflow distribution. High-performance aluminum tube technology provides advantages in lightweight design and efficient thermal conductivity, making it suitable for refrigeration equipment that requires compact structures and stable cooling output.
- Optimized tube structures improve refrigerant circulation efficiency and heat exchange capability.
- Lightweight aluminum materials help reduce overall equipment weight.
- Efficient fin designs improve air contact area and cooling performance.
- Stable heat transfer performance supports long-term freezer operation.

Durability Verification for Long-Term Freezer Operation
Freezer systems often operate continuously for thousands of hours, so radiator components must withstand repeated temperature changes, moisture exposure, and pressure fluctuations. A reliable finned tube radiator requires strong corrosion resistance and mechanical stability to maintain consistent heat exchange performance throughout its service life.

Fin Structure Design and Airflow Management
The fin structure of a freezer radiator directly affects airflow efficiency and heat transfer results. Proper fin spacing allows sufficient air movement while maintaining a large heat exchange surface. If fins are designed too densely, airflow resistance may increase and frost accumulation may become more difficult to manage.
For different freezer applications, engineers usually adjust fin spacing, tube arrangement, and radiator dimensions according to cooling requirements. Commercial freezers, cold storage systems, and compact refrigeration equipment may require different designs to achieve the best balance between cooling performance and energy consumption.
- Suitable fin spacing improves airflow distribution.
- Optimized tube arrangement enhances refrigerant-side heat transfer.
- Customized structures help match different freezer installation requirements.
Maintenance Considerations for Freezer Heat Exchanger Performance
Even high-quality freezer radiators require proper maintenance to maintain efficiency. Dust accumulation, airflow blockage, and excessive frost layers can reduce heat exchange effectiveness and increase energy consumption. Regular inspection of airflow channels and surface cleanliness helps refrigeration systems maintain stable operation.
In cold chain applications, where temperature accuracy is critical, radiator performance directly affects product preservation quality. Selecting a heat exchanger with reliable corrosion resistance and structural strength can reduce maintenance frequency and improve system availability.
